The TSS (Tuple Space Search) algorithm in Open vSwitch 2.x through 2.17.2 and 3.0.0 allows remote attackers to cause a denial of service (delays of legitimate traffic) via crafted packet data that requires excessive evaluation time within the packet classification algorithm for the MegaFlow cache, aka a Tuple Space Explosion (TSE) attack.
{
"binaries": [
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-common"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-source"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-test"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"2.13.8-0ubuntu1.4",
"binary_name": "python3-openvswitch"
}
]
}{
"binaries": [
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-common"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-ipsec"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-source"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-test"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"2.17.9-0ubuntu0.22.04.1",
"binary_name": "python3-openvswitch"
}
]
}{
"binaries": [
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-common"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-ipsec"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-source"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-test"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"3.3.4-0ubuntu0.24.04.1",
"binary_name": "python3-openvswitch"
}
]
}{
"binaries": [
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-common"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-ipsec"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-source"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-test"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"3.6.0-2",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"3.6.0-2",
"binary_name": "python3-openvswitch"
}
]
}{
"binaries": [
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-common"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-ipsec"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-test"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"ovn-central"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"ovn-common"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"ovn-docker"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"ovn-host"
},
{
"binary_version": "2.5.9-0ubuntu0.16.04.3+esm1",
"binary_name": "python-openvswitch"
}
]
}{
"binaries": [
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-common"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-pki"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-switch"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-switch-dpdk"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-test"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-testcontroller"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"openvswitch-vtep"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"ovn-central"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"ovn-common"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"ovn-controller-vtep"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"ovn-docker"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"ovn-host"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"python-openvswitch"
},
{
"binary_version": "2.9.8-0ubuntu0.18.04.5+esm1",
"binary_name": "python3-openvswitch"
}
]
}